Absa's solution simplifies the motor comprehensive insurance application process, enabling dealership Finance & Insurance Managers to close deals more efficiently and expedite vehicle releases. This integrated approach provides customers with a seamless and comprehensive outcome for both their finance and motor comprehensive insurance applications. When a Finance & Insurance Manager receives the outcome of a finance application, the Absa Podium displays both the finance results and two motor comprehensive insurance quote options.
Customers can choose from two insurance quotations provided by Absa Insurance Company: one with telematics, which enables them to earn Absa Rewards, and the other without telematics. Absa's integrated Finance & Insurance solution is designed with both dealers and customers in mind. Finance & Insurance Managers benefit from faster turnaround times on insurance quotes, quicker vehicle delivery, and an even quicker payout process. Customers enjoy competitive insurance premiums and gain access to the exclusive benefits of Absa Rewards.
Absa Motor Comprehensive insurance quotes are not limited to Absa-financed deals, they can also be offered for all financed deals and cash transactions. However, the Finance & Insurance Manager must refer to the Absa Podium to review the insurance quotations. Currently, Absa Insurance Motor Comprehensive quotes are available exclusively for vehicles in private use within the South African Development Community (SADC).

The Toyota Starlet has improved from zero to a four-star rating for adult occupant protection in Global NCAP's latest #SaferCarsForAfrica crash test results. This follows a safety upgrade to make six airbags a standard fit.
